Chief Thomas Tremblay, Burlington Police Department gave an Information Update on Friday October 13, 2006 at 4:30 p.m. This is the text of that statement:

It is with a heavy heart and a great sense of sadness on the part of the citizens of Burlington and the Vermont law enforcement community that I address you this afternoon.

Earlier this afternoon police received initial information about a woman's body being found off Dugway Road in Richmond. An immediate response by members of the Vermont State Police, Burlington Police, and the FBI confirmed the presence of a woman's body and she has tentatively been identified by investigators as Michelle Gardner-Quinn. The manner of Michelle's death appears to be a homicide pending confirmation from the Vermont Chief Medical Examiner's Office. We expect that the medical exam will also officially confirm her identity.

The Dugway Road in Richmond had not yet been searched by ground or air teams involved in the efforts to locate Michelle.

Based on this discovery and other information, we are now prepared to identify Brian Rooney, 36, of Richmond as a suspect in Michelle's disappearance. He has been the focus of our investigation since the initial briefings when we described our investigation proceeding in a specific direction. Our investigation continues into Mr. Rooney's involvement.

A short time ago, Mr. Rooney was arrested and is currently in police custody on charges unrelated to the disappearance of Michelle. Those charges include Sexual Assault, Attempted Sexual Assault, and Lewd & Lascivious Conduct with a Child. Each of the charges stems from events that occurred well before Michelle's disappearance. We anticipate that Rooney will be arraigned on those charges in Caledonia County District Court on Monday. A time is currently unavailable. Mr. Rooney is in police custody at this time and will be lodged at the Chittenden Regional Correctional Facility later this evening.

There is an extensive investigation still being conducted regarding the circumstances surrounding Michelle's disappearance and all additional leads will be followed. We continue to seek the public's assistance in providing information about Mr. Rooney during the time period between 2:30 a.m. Saturday and Monday October 16th. We continue to seek information about the red Jeep Grand Cherokee that we released a picture of earlier today.
